Getting to Darjeeling is very easy. One can reach the place both by rail, road or air. The nearest airport Bagdogra is at a distance of 96 km. New Jalpaiguri is the nearest rail route. However, one can reach Darjeeling easily from any part of India like Kolkata, Delhi, Guwahati, or Madras. It is well connected via rail route to Bombay, Bangalore, Bhubaneshwar, Tirupati, Trivandrum and Cochin.
Tourist Attractions in Darjeeling:
- Tiger Hill in Darjeeling: This is considered the highest peak of Darjeeling, from where one can have a glimpse of the majestic Kanchenjunga. The Senchal Lake is a hot favorite picnic spot.
- The Bhutia Busty Gompa in Darjeeling and the Yogachoeling Gompa/Ghoom are the two most important gompas of Darjeeling. The Samdenchoeling, Sakyachoeling, Phin Sotholing, Aloobari, and Thupten Sangachoeling are the monasteries here.
- The Dhirdham temple in Darjeeling is one of the most important holy places of the Hindus here.
- Bengal natural History museum stores a large collection of the flora and fauna of the Himalayas. The Padmaja Naidu Himalayan Zoological Park and the Lloyd Botanical Gardens are the other places to visit while Going Around Darjeeling.
The other attractions of include the Tea Gardens in Darjeeling and the Himalayan Mountaineering Institute in Darjeeling.
